Yousef Al Otaiba, UAE Ambassador to the US, said the tripartite announcement on Thursday regarding UAE-Israel relations is a significant advance for the region and for diplomacy.
In a statement after a joint statement issued by His Highness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Crown Prince of Abu Dhabi and Deputy Supreme Commander of the UAE Armed Forces, US President Donald Trump, and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, Al Otaiba said it immediately stops annexation and the potential of violent escalation. It maintains the viability of a two-state solution as endorsed by the Arab League.

"It is a significant advance in Arab-Israeli relations that lowers tensions and creates new energy for positive change across the region. As two of the Middle East's most dynamic economies and vibrant societies, closer UAE-Israeli ties will accelerate growth and innovation, expand opportunities for young people, and breakdown long-held prejudices. It will help move the region beyond a troubled legacy of hostility to a more hopeful destiny of peace and prosperity," he said.

He said the UAE will continue to remain a strong supporter of the Palestinian people - for their dignity, their rights and their own sovereign state. "They must benefit too in normalisation. As we have for fifty years, we will forcefully advocate for these ends, now directly and bolstered with stronger incentives, policy options and diplomatic tools."
